
On May 21, 2026, Air India flight AI2802 from Bengaluru to Delhi declared a full emergency at Indira Gandhi International Airport following a suspected engine fire alert during final approach. The Airbus A320 landed safely on runway 29R at around 9:30 p.m. with 160-171 passengers onboard. Emergency services were deployed, and no injuries were reported. Air India confirmed the incident, stating the crew followed standard procedures and has initiated a full investigation with regulatory authorities.
